Saves the configuration of a Dashboard control in string format. This configuration includes the following elements:
  • position of internal windows/pages in the Dashboard control.
  • size of internal windows/pages in the Dashboard control.
  • visibility of internal windows/pages in the Dashboard control.
Remark: To automatically save or restore the user configuration, check "Remember configuration of Widgets" in the "Details" tab of the control description window.
Example
WINDEV
// Asks the user for the backup file
sFile is string
 
// Opens the file picker
sFile = fSelect("", "", "Select a configuration file...", ...
"Dashboard configuration" + TAB + "*.dashconf", "*.dashconf", ...
fselCreate + fselExist)
// If a file is selected
IF sFile <> "" THEN
// Gets the current configuration in a string
sConfiguration is string = DashSaveConfiguration(DASH_Dashboard)
// Saves the configuration
IF fSaveText(sFile, sConfiguration) THEN
ToastDisplay("The configuration was saved", toastShort, vaMiddle, haCenter)
ELSE
Error("Error while saving the configuration file", ErrorInfo())
END
END
WEBDEV - Server code
// Save a configuration
sMyConfig is string
sMyConfig = DashSaveConfiguration(DASH_TimeZones)
fSaveText(fWebDir() + ["\"] + "DashConfig.tdb", sMyConfig)
Syntax
<Result> = DashSaveConfiguration(<Dashboard control>)
<Result>: Character string
Configuration of Dashboard control.
This configuration can be saved by fSaveText or SaveParameter.
This configuration can be restored by DashLoadConfiguration.
<Dashboard control>: Control name
Name of the Dashboard control to be used.
